LEGO IKEA BYGGLEK Collection Officially Revealed

LEGO and IKEA has officially revealed their new collaboration project with BYGGLEK which was announced in June 2018. The collection aims to encourage more play around the home. We’ve already got a first look at it a few months ago when it was put out early but BYGGLEK will be available starting on October 1 in North America and throughout Europe.

Play, display and replay: IKEA® and the LEGO Group introduce BYGGLEK – a creative solution that intertwines play and storage

August 27, 2020: Today, IKEA of Sweden AB and the LEGO Group reveal the long-awaited outcome of their collaboration. The two brands have joined forces to create a playful storage solution called BYGGLEK. Consisting of a series of storage boxes with LEGO® studs and a special LEGO brick set, the new BYGGLEK collection aims to encourage play and infuse more fun into storage around the home. The BYGGLEK collection will start to be available in existing IKEA retail channels throughout Europe (except Russia) and North America from October 1. The global roll-out will happen in 2020. (Check online for local availability).

With a strong belief that play makes both the home and the world a better place, IKEA of Sweden AB and the LEGO Group set out to remove barriers to play in daily life, whilst creating a practical yet playful experience that children and adults could enjoy together.

LEGO Star Wars Bespin Duel (75294) Now Available on Shop@Home

The LEGO Star Wars Bespin Duel (75294) is now available for purchase on Shop@Home. The set has 295 pieces and retails for $39.99. It is an event item for the now cancelled Star Wars Celebration 2020 convention and won’t be available outside of North America. Fans in Canada are also able to get it as well. Bespin Duel recreates the iconic scene on Cloud City from Star Wars: The Empire Strikes Back where Luke learns that Darth Vader is his father.

Update: It is now also available at Target with a limit of 1 per household.

LEGO World Builder Platform Officially Announced

LEGO has partnered with Tongal to launch a brand new story development platform called LEGO World Builder. This opportunity gives LEGO fans direct access to the LEGO creative team to develop stories, shows, and more.

If you remember, LEGO asked for beta testers back in April for a new project and the end result is LEGO World Builder. Since LEGO has been getting tons of ideas from fans for new content, LEGO World Builder will allow fans to create the content themselves to show off which includes using existing LEGO IP. Head on over to worldbuilder.tongal.com get started.

The LEGO Group partners with Tongal to launch LEGO® World Builder, a first-of-its-kind platform for developing stories, shows and more

The platform opens unprecedented, direct access to the LEGO creative team for a worldwide creator community, revolutionizing the way new talent and stories are discovered

Los Angeles and New York – August 24, 2020 – The LEGO Group and content creation platform Tongal announced today the launch of LEGO® World Builder, a first-of-its-kind story development platform that gives the LEGO fan community and creative talent all over the world direct access to the LEGO creative team to develop stories, shows, and more.

LEGO World Builder, designed in partnership with Tongal and powered by Tongal’s technology, connects a worldwide creator community to the LEGO Group, who can incubate ideas, collaborate, give feedback, and option or buy the rights to new concepts. AFOL Posters – Profiles from Space Now Available

A new collaboration between Bricks on the Dollar’s AFOL Posters & artist Ben Turner: Profiles From Space! The first 5 designs are completed and available for purchase. Blacktron I, Space Police I, and all three characters from Ice Planet 2002 are all depicted in either their visor-up or visor-down form.

These 8″x8″ cardstock prints are the first in a new series from AFOL Posters and are flat-shipped anywhere in the world. Prints are USD $30 each shipped worldwide with combo discounts for buying sets of 5 or even a full set of 10. Blacktron II & M:Tron are currently in production and will be released as soon as possible. Inexpensive 8″x8″ frames are available from Walmart.

LEGO Ideas Naruto: Ichiraku Ramen Shop Achieves 10,000 Supporters

The Naruto: Ichiraku Ramen Shop by DadiTwins is the latest project to achieve 10,000 supporters on LEGO Ideas. The build features the iconic Ichiraku Ramen Shop from the Naruto manga/anime and it has lots of details on the interior and exterior. At its current state, it has 1,6000 pieces and includes seven minifigures: Naruto Uzumaki, Sasuke Uchiha, Sakura Haruno, Kakashi Hatake, Teuchi Ichiraku, Ayame Ichiraku, Iruka Umino.
